T20 World Cup 2021: Virat Kohli opens up on dropping Chahal & backing Ashwin and Chahar

T20 World Cup: After leaving most cricket experts in shock by not picking Yuzvendra Chahal in Team India's squad for the T20 World Cup, Virat Kohli has finally cleared the air as to why he was left out.

The Indian skipper admitted that it was a difficult and a challenging call but clarified that Rahul Chahar was preferred as he bowls with pace. "The wickets in UAE will be slow and the guys who bowl with some pace, attack the stumps and that is the factor that tipped the balance in favour of Rahul," Kohli added. 

Virat Kohli also stated that Ashwin has been rewarded for reviving his white-ball bowling and he is bowling with a lot of courage.
